Output 20493176ad260acc74390969dfbaf8d3ee71bfc8ff6622d513262983e21ec2ce:151

value
322375
script pubkey
OP_0 OP_PUSHBYTES_20 39cdaa34cb881d8ef4679eb538f14824e02c68a6
address
bc1q88x65dxt3qwcaar8n66n3u2gynszc69xk5tyu5
transaction
20493176ad260acc74390969dfbaf8d3ee71bfc8ff6622d513262983e21ec2ce
spent
true